lumberyard-employee-dm 9060423592 Settings registry notification deadlock fix (#3065)
* Added a StealHandlers function to AZ Event

The StealHandlers function is able to take all the handlers from an AZ
Event parameter and register them with the current AZ Event

This allows stealing handlers from expiring AZ Events, which is useful
for a lock and swap algorithm for thread safety.
1. Lock persistent AZ::Event
2. Swap persistent AZ::Event with local AZ::Event
3. Unlock persistent AZ::Event - Other threads can now add to this
   AZ::Event
4. Invoke handlers from local AZ::Event
5. Relock persistent AZ::Event
5. Swap local AZ::Event with persistent AZ::Event
6. Local AZ::Event now contains handlers that were added when the lock
   was free
7. Persistent AZ::Event now steals from local AZ::Event
8. Unlock persistent AZ::Event
